Sunrise on the Reaping: A Hunger Games Prequel
Uncover Panem's Bloodiest Rebellion in This Gripping Paperback
Return to the arena where hope was forged in fire. Sunrise on the Reaping chronicles the brutal 50th Hunger Games (the Quarter Quell)—the Capitol’s cruelest spectacle that sparked a legend. Follow Haymitch Abernathy (future mentor to Katniss) as he navigates a deadly contest with twice as many tributes and triple the betrayal. This prequel unveils hidden lore that reshapes our understanding of Panem’s past and sets the stage for the rebellion.
